When Bayern Munich winger Kingsley Coman went down yesterday, fans everywhere no doubt let out a collective groan assuming the worst.
There is good news, however, as the injury does not look to be serious. Per a release from FCBayern.com, Coman’s injury is minor and just a strain:
Kingsley Coman only sustained a strain in his left hamstring during Saturday’s Bundesliga top-of-the-table clash at Bayer 04 Leverkusen. This was confirmed by a scan carried out by the FC Bayern medical department. The France international was substituted in the 33rd minute at the BayArena.
This is obviously fantastic news as Coman can take the next few days to heal and should be ready for the start of the Rückrunde on January 3rd against Mainz 05.
Coman has been the team’s best winger this season as he has tallied five goals and nine assists in 15 games across all competitions. With Serge Gnabry and Leroy Sané both struggling at times of late, Coman’s presence will be an enormous boost as the squad seeks to win another treble.
